Course Content

• **Pharmaceutical M&A Deal Structuring & Negotiation:** This unit covers the intricacies of deal structuring, including valuation, due diligence, and negotiation tactics specific to the pharmaceutical industry.
• **Regulatory Compliance in Pharma M&A:** This module focuses on navigating FDA regulations, antitrust laws, and other critical compliance aspects during mergers and acquisitions in the pharmaceutical sector.
• **Communication Strategies for Successful Integration:** This unit explores effective internal and external communication strategies to manage stakeholder expectations and ensure a smooth integration process post-merger.
• **Crisis Communication in Pharma M&A:** This module covers developing and implementing effective crisis communication plans to address potential issues and mitigate reputational damage.
• **Financial Reporting & Transparency in Pharma M&A:** This unit emphasizes the importance of transparent and accurate financial reporting during all phases of the M&A process.
• **Intellectual Property (IP) Due Diligence & Communication:** This unit focuses on the crucial role of IP in Pharma M&A and the communication strategies needed to navigate its complexities.
• **Stakeholder Management in Pharma M&A Transactions:** This module covers techniques for identifying, engaging, and managing stakeholders (employees, investors, regulators, etc.) throughout the M&A process.
• **Cross-Cultural Communication in Global Pharma M&A:** This unit addresses the challenges of cross-cultural communication in international pharmaceutical mergers and acquisitions.

Career path

Career Role Description
Pharma M&A Communication Strategist Develops and executes communication plans for complex M&A transactions, ensuring effective internal and external messaging. Manages stakeholder relationships.
Senior Pharma M&A Communications Manager Leads communication strategy across multiple M&A deals simultaneously. Provides expert guidance on crisis communication and regulatory compliance.
Pharmaceutical Mergers & Acquisitions Consultant (Communications Focus) Advises clients on all aspects of communication during the M&A process. Provides strategic counsel and tactical execution support. Deep understanding of regulatory frameworks.
M&A Project Manager (Communications Specialist) Oversees the communication elements of complex M&A projects. Ensures timely and accurate information flow to all stakeholders, while managing budgets and resources.
